Overview

Rajasthan's ongoing appeal is evidence of its spectacular beauty, extensive history, and dynamic culture. From the magnificent Amer Fort in Jaipur to the opulent City Palace in Udaipur, this state in northwest India is home to an array of architectural wonders. Visitors are transported to a bygone period of wealth by the magnificent palaces and havelis that are decorated with elaborate frescoes.

Rajasthan's bright festivals, traditional music, and mouthwatering cuisine, which includes delicacies like dal baati churma and gatte ki sabzi, all alluring. A rainbow of colours may be seen in its cities, such as Jodhpur, Jaipur, and Udaipur, ranging from the azure homes of Jodhpur's old town to the pink walls of Jaipur's ancient district.

The state's beauty may be seen in both its natural surroundings and the friendly hospitality of its residents. Rajasthan continues to be a top choice for tourists looking for an authentic and enthralling Indian experience because of its unique blend of history, culture, and friendliness.

Mount Abu - Jodhpur

Drive to Jodhpur. The city of Jodhpur, which is located on the Thar Desert's eastern edge, exudes the elegance of a city state. The "Blue City" is a slang term for Jodhpur, the second-largest city in Rajasthan. Given that the majority of the structures, including forts, palaces, temples, havelis, and even residences, are constructed in vivid blue tones, the term is appropriate. Powerful forts, beautiful temples, and havelis are just a few of the attractions that it offers, along with the best means of transportation.
Visit the Mehrangarh Fort, Jaswant Thada, Mandore Garden, Umaid Bhawan Palace, and take a boat ride on Balsamand Lake at dusk. Overnight stay.
